Rewilding Station 511 Pollinator Garden

A small native-plant pollinator garden ideal for close-up shots of bees, butterflies and blooming wildflowers. Best visited spring–early fall when blooms peak; mid-morning (9–11am) yields active insects and good directional light, golden hour offers warm backlight and silhouettes. Likely roadside/community-site parking; usually free and accessible but bring insect repellent and respect plantings. Quiet, intimate location for macro and shallow-depth floral work.
